We established the range of concentrations at baseline and during aspirin challenge. The eicosanoids in the EBC together with the LTE4 in the urine were measured in all groups. In addition the 9allßPGF2 was measured in the blood of the adult patients and the nitric oxide (FeNO) was measured in children. In contrast to the previously studies we employed the following methods: a common protocol for measurments EBC (Kraków, Zürich), the analytical methods that were more sensitive and specific, the analysis of mediator profiles. This study suggests it is useful to employ GC/MS and RIA in the analysis of eicosanoids in the EBC. A measurement of cys-LTs in the EBC has a diagnostic value in asthmatic children, cys-LTs levels were elevated in asthmatic children despite the treatment with inhaled corticosteroids and atopy. Any of the eicosanoids in the EBC does not discriminate adult patients with asthma from the healthy. Measurement of the LTE4 levels in urine has the best diagnostic value in AIA. Low levels of 9a11ßPGF2 in the EBC in AIA patients warrants further investigation.
